Dr Who: The Millennium Trap
In the years between the end of the old series of Dr Who and the new Russell T. Davies version, fans of the series made their own episodes and films.
Probably the most accomplished of these was 1997's Dr Who: The Millennium Trap which sees The Doctor (played here by Nick Scovell) taking on his old foes - the Daleks. Filmed in B+W this is basically a homage to the shows from the 1960s. Now director Rob Thrush has restored the film with new CGI and some editing. He is planning to release this restored version as a free DVD download from the 23rd of November. Here is the trailer, together with the announcement of the restored release: For a 'Dr Who Confidential' on the Millennium Trap, check out: This same team made 4 acclaimed stage productions of various wiped BBC episodes too.
